A talented wordsmith with a passion for farm life will write his or her way into owning a 35-acre Virginia horse farm.
Rock Spring Farm in Essex County, Va., has been owned by Randy Silvers, his late wife, Margie, and his second wife, Carolyn Berry, for more than two decades.
However, that’s about to change. And although the farm is worth an estimated $600,000, it will be sold for a nominal fee of $200.
That’s because Silver and Berry aren’t selling the farm at all, but rather giving it away to the winner of an essay contest that began in March of this year. The winner and two runners-up will be chosen from 25 finalists in late-November.
